Abstract

The utility model discloses a P-type anchorage device at a fixed end. The P-type anchorage device comprises an extrusion anchor, an anchoring base plate, a steel strand, spiral bars, a slurry outlet pipe, a constraint ring and a corrugated pipe, wherein one end of the steel strand sequentially penetrates through the corrugated pipe and the constraint ring, and the other end of the steel strand is sequentially connected with the anchoring base plate and the extrusion anchor and is anchored; the constraint ring and the slurry outlet pipe are arranged on the steel strand which penetrates through the corrugated pipe; the spiral bars are arranged outside the constraint ring; the P-type anchorage device also comprises an anchorage device open sleeve and a retaining ring; the anchorage device open sleeve is arranged between the anchoring base plate and the extrusion anchor; the retaining ring is arranged at the rear end of the anchoring base plate. The utility model aims to solve the problems of manufacturing of the extrusion anchor in a narrow space and overall placement of the manufactured anchoring base plate and a prestressed cable in the case with effective prestressed application length. According to the P-type anchorage device, the construction difficulty of the P-type anchorage device at the fixed end in a narrow manufacturing space is reduced, the working efficiency is improved, the construction quality is improved, and the effective prestressed length of the member is increased.

Background technology
For the continuous cast-in-place one-end tension member of many Pin, for improving effective prestress, apply length, the making space of fixed end P type ground tackle is often narrower and small, for the conventional way of this problem for bellows to be just installed after the colligation of member outer reinforcement and to reeve from stretching end, when being made extruding anchor by pull end, bellows must be divided and make two joints, wherein fixed according to field fabrication space requirement by pull end one joint length, this joint is bigger compared with another joint, before making, extruding anchor will by rotation, be entangled another joint by pull end bellows, after making extruding anchor, integral body is drawn to design attitude location by anchor plate and prestressed cable, and then rotate by pull end bellows to design attitude, difficulty of construction is larger, major embodiment is in the following areas:
(1) owing to making the needs in space, before extruding anchor is made, anchor plate is generally positioned at inclined to one side stretching end one side of design attitude, after extruding anchor completes, need integral body to drag anchor plate and prestressed cable to design attitude, the long rope more to radical, pulls difficulty larger, efficiency of construction is low, easily causes bellows skew simultaneously.
(2), when by pull end plain bars comparatively dense, integral body drags anchor plate and prestressed cable can cause the skew of already installed plain bars position, need to adjust plain bars, increases workload.
(3) existing P type ground tackle is owing to making narrow space, and after moulding, quality is difficult for guaranteeing, affects anchoring property.
For the continuous cast-in-place one-end tension member of many Pin, in the situation that guaranteeing effective prestress application length, for reducing difficulty of construction, increase work efficiency, just need to solve extruding anchor in small space make and complete after anchor plate and the Integral in-position problem of prestressed cable.

The specific embodiment
Below in conjunction with the drawings and specific embodiments, the utility model is described in further detail:
As shown in the figure, the utility model comprises extruding anchor 4, anchor plate 2, steel strand 5, spiral bar 6, outlet pipe 7, constraint circle 8, bellows 9, one end of described steel strand 5 is successively through bellows 9 and constraint circle 8, the other end of steel strand 5 is connected with extruding anchor 4 with anchor plate 2 and anchoring successively, through being provided with on the steel strand 5 of bellows 9, retraining circle 8 and outlet pipe 7, constraint circle 8 outsides are provided with spiral bar 6, it is characterized in that, it also comprises ground tackle opening sleeve 3 and clasp 1, between described anchor plate 2 and extruding anchor 4, be provided with ground tackle opening sleeve 3, the rear end of described anchor plate 2 is provided with C type clasp 1.Wherein, described ground tackle opening sleeve 3 is two lobe formulas.
During use, after the colligation of member outer reinforcement completes, bellows 9 is installed, the subsidiary steel strand 5 of having made extruding anchor 4 is passed to bellows 9, and put constraint circle 8 and spiral bar 6.Accurately location and installation anchor plate 2, drags steel strand 5 and extruding anchor 4 is passed to anchor plate 2 by root.Ground tackle opening sleeve 3 is installed, is utilized C type retaining ring tongs C type clasp 1 to be installed with fixing ground tackle opening sleeve 3, by root, adjust steel strand 5 and make extruding anchor 4 near ground tackle opening sleeve 3.Constraint circle 8 and outlet pipe 7 are installed.Binding structural member internal layer reinforcing bar, concreting, maintenance tension steel strand 5, carry out vacuum grouting to bellows 9.Described steel strand 5 are through extruding anchor 4, ground tackle opening sleeve 3, anchor plate 2, C type clasp 1, spiral bar 6, constraint circle 8 and bellows 9.Described steel strand 5 are formed and are reliably connected by special extruder extruding with extruding anchor 4.Perforate on described anchor plate 2 is because the use of ground tackle opening sleeve 3 is large compared with conventional anchor backing plate.Described ground tackle opening sleeve 3 is two lobe formulas, through fixing by C type clasp 1 after anchor plate 2.Described steel strand 5 are after tension, and by vacuum grouting process, being in the milk to be sealed in is applied in prestressed member.In addition, all component is all embedded in concrete.
